Building with Perspective - Treehouse Fabrication & Scenic is a seasoned team of craftsmen and craftswomen who transform impressive visions into tangible realities, delivering custom-fabricated environments for both brands and agencies Summary of Position: The Estimating & Procurement Manager is responsible for developing accurate project estimates, maintaining consistent project budgets in NetSuite, and managing the sourcing and purchasing of materials, rentals, and subcontracted services. This role works closely with project management, design, production, and accounting to ensure projects are priced accurately, purchasing is planned proactively, vendor costs are controlled, and project expenses are properly tracked. The position plays a key role in reducing COGS, limiting unnecessary last-minute spending, managing vendor relationships, and improving visibility into committed and actual project costs. Job Responsibilities: Estimating & Budget Development Develop detailed project estimates covering labor, materials, subcontractors, rentals, transportation, installation, and other project-related costs. Review scopes of work, drawings, specifications, schedules, and client requirements to identify anticipated project costs. Create RFP folders and organizing client assets Coordinate with Project Managers, Technical Designers, and production leadership to confirm construction methods, labor requirements, material needs, and project assumptions. Obtain vendor, subcontractor, rental, and material pricing to support accurate and competitive estimates. Enter estimates and project budgets into NetSuite using established formatting, cost categories, and financial tracking procedures. Prepare MSAs and SOWs from approved company templates. Clearly document estimate assumptions, exclusions, allowances, vendor quotes, and pricing qualifications. Revise estimates and budgets as project scope, drawings, schedules, or client requirements change. Support the handoff of approved estimates and budgets to Project Managers, production teams, and accounting. Review estimated costs against actual project expenses to identify variances and improve the accuracy of future estimates. Procurement and Vendor Management Source materials, equipment, rentals, transportation, and subcontracted services for active and upcoming projects. Evaluate vendors based on pricing, quality, availability, lead times, reliability, payment terms, and project requirements. Develop and maintain strong relationships with suppliers, subcontractors, rental companies, and service providers. Negotiate pricing, payment terms, delivery costs, volume discounts, and preferred-vendor agreements. Procuring printing, logistics, specialty items, rentals, travel, engineering, and other non-fabrication elements. Book project travel. Regularly compare vendors and sourcing options to identify opportunities to reduce COGS without compromising quality, safety, or project schedules. Coordinate purchasing with Project Managers and production leadership to ensure materials and services are secured before they are needed. Cost Control and Spending Management Create and maintain accurate purchase orders in NetSuite for materials, rentals, subcontractors, transportation, and other project-related purchases. Monitor purchasing activity to ensure project expenditures remain aligned with approved estimates and budgets. Review urgent purchasing requests to confirm necessity, budget availability, and whether a more cost-effective sourcing option is available. Reduce unnecessary retail purchases and supply runs from vendors such as Home Depot by improving material forecasting, advance purchasing, and vendor coordination. Participating in project kickoff meetings and communicating budget, purchasing, and delivery information.
